DR PUNEET SINGH
PhD/MClinPsych, BPsych(Hons), A.M.A.P.S
Dr Puneet Singh is a qualified Clinical Psychologist. She holds an Honours degree in Psychology, and has a PhD and Masters in Clinical Psychology from Macquarie University. Puneet is registered with the NSW Psychologist registration board and is an associate member of the Australian Psychological Society.
Puneet has provided assessment and treatment for children, adolescents and adults who experience anxiety, depression, stress, interpersonal difficulties, and trauma. She has a particular interest in anxiety and has received specialist training in this area from the Emotional Health Clinic (previously known as Macquarie University Anxiety Research Unit).
She is currently involved in treatment and research at the Emotional Health Clinic. She uses several evidence based therapies with her main therapeutic approach being cognitive behaviour therapy and schema therapy. She has a keen interest in mindfulness based approaches and acceptance and commitment therapy.
Puneet’s PhD research examined coping strategies that help children and adolescents deal more effectively with school bullying. She received the University medal for her PhD thesis, as well as numerous awards and scholarships for academic and research excellence. She regularly presents at local and international conferences. Puneet brings a warm and sensitive approach to clients and has a strong interest in fostering positive change in their lives.
